DeepSeekHarness RC.8: Multimodal input and ClaudeCode/Codex sub-agents
机器之心 · wechat · 2026-08-20
DeepSeek released the RC.8 version of its open-source agent framework, DeepSeekHarness. Key updates include:
- Multimodal Support: Native image requests for model adapters, mixed text/image input in core commands, and file/history context referencing via the @ menu.
- Sub-agent Integration: ClaudeCode and Codex can now be installed as ProfileBundles and invoked as sub-agents. Codex supports a non-interactive mode and multiple named instances.
- Workflow Improvements: Concurrent web search, proactive parent-task awakening by sub-agents, and persistent PowerShell sessions for Windows.
- Fixes: Resolved issues regarding image payload limits, streaming interruptions, and gateway compatibility, alongside simplified SDK dependencies.
